Factors to Consider When Choosing Luggage Sets 3 Piece
When you choose a 3-piece luggage set, start with material durability, since your bags need to handle bumps, drops, and rough baggage belts without falling apart. Next, check the size, wheel performance, and handle comfort, because the right fit and easy movement can save you a lot of travel stress. Also, don’t skip security features, since good locks and strong zippers help you feel more at ease when you’re on the move.
Material Durability
Material durability is where a good 3-piece luggage set earns your trust, because the right shell or fabric can save you from a cracked case and a travel headache. If you want hard protection, look for polycarbonate, ABS, or PC and ABS blends, since they handle impact well and keep fragile items safer. If you prefer softside bags, high-density oxford fabric can resist abrasion, water, and stains, while still flexing into tighter spots. Next, check the build, because reinforced corners and textured finishes help hide scuffs and spread impact. Also, don’t ignore the parts you grab and roll every trip: metal handles, smooth bearings, strong double-spinner wheels, and YKK zippers all shape how long your set lasts. Manufacturer drop tests and warranties give you proof, not promises.
Size And Capacity
Once you know the shell can handle the trip, the next thing to get right is size and capacity, because the wrong fit can leave you stuffing too much into one bag or paying for space you never use. A 20-inch carry-on usually gives you about 40 to 45 liters, so it works well for short business trips and no-check travel. The 24-inch bag gives you about 58 to 70 liters, which fits most 3 to 7 day trips. The 28-inch case adds about 75 to 85 liters, so it suits long vacations or shared packing. If you want extra room, choose expandability, but watch the added weight. Also, use smart pockets and compression straps so you carry more without upsizing.
Wheel Performance
Glide through the terminal with the right wheels, because they can make your whole trip feel lighter. When you shop for a 3-piece set, choose 360° spinner wheels so you can steer through crowds without tugging at your arm. Single wheels can work well, but double-wheel spinners usually feel steadier and spread weight better, so your bag is less likely to tip. Next, look for soft TPU treads and sealed ball bearings. They roll more quietly and cut down vibration, which makes long walks feel easier. Also, check for shock-absorbing housings and reinforced mounts, since they help the wheels handle bumps and curb drops. Finally, count the spinners and review load ratings. Four or eight evaluated wheels often mean better life, smoother travel, and fewer travel-day surprises.
Handle Comfort
After you pick wheels that roll smoothly, the next thing your hands and shoulders will notice is the handle. You want an adjustable telescoping handle with 2 or 3 height stops, so you can set it where your arm feels relaxed. Soft rubber or TPU grips help you hold on longer, and the contoured shape keeps your hands from tiring out. Also, check that the shaft is aluminum or reinforced metal, because sturdy parts cut wobble and feel steadier when the bag is full. Padded top and side carry handles matter too, since you’ll lift the set into bins and trunks more often than you think. Finally, look for tight locking and a solid load rating, because a steady handle makes travel feel a lot easier.
Security Features
Security matters just as much as space when you choose a 3-piece luggage set, because a strong lock can save you a lot of stress at the airport. You should look for TSA-approved combination locks, since they let screeners inspect your bag without cutting anything off. Next, check the zippers. Puncture-resistant or double-stitched zippers, plus zipper guards, make it harder for someone to pry them open with tools. Also, choose hard-shell bags or reinforced lock housings, because they help shield the lock from bumps and forced entry. Multi-point locking systems are even better, since they secure several zipper heads at once. Finally, inspect the hardware. Metal lock parts, reinforced zipper tape, and riveted attachments usually last longer and feel more dependable.
Interior Organization
Once you know your bags are locked up well, the next thing to check is how easily you can keep everything organized inside. You’ll want interior compartments that fit your routine, like U-shaped zip pockets, full-zip dividers, and mesh pouches. These help you separate shoes, toiletries, and electronics so you’re not digging like a raccoon at baggage claim. Compression straps or X-shaped cross straps matter too, because they hold clothes in place and cut down on wrinkles. If you travel with tech, look for padded laptop sleeves and pockets for chargers and cables. Removable wet/dry pouches are handy for spills and damp items. Also, check the number and size of pockets, since your packing style should guide how much access you need on the move.
Frequently Asked Questions
Are 3-Piece Luggage Sets Airline Carry-On Compliant?
Some 3 piece luggage sets include a carry on that meets airline size limits, but not all sets do. Check the exact dimensions of each bag against your airline’s carry on rules before you travel.
How Do I Clean Hard Shell Luggage Without Damaging It?
Start by wiping the shell with a soft microfiber cloth dampened in warm water mixed with a small amount of gentle liquid soap. Rinse the cloth and remove any soap residue, then dry the surface promptly with a clean, dry cloth. Avoid abrasive cleaners and harsh chemical products because they can dull the finish and cause scratches.
Do All Luggage Sets Include a Warranty?
No. Warranties are not automatic with every luggage set. Check the specific brand and retailer policies because coverage differs by manufacturer, seller, and price point. Some sets include limited protection while others provide no warranty at all.
Can TSA Locks Be Reset by the Owner?
Yes. If you know the current combination or the lock’s specific reset procedure you can reset most TSA locks yourself.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ions precisely to avoid being unable to open the lock.
Which Luggage Material Resists Scratches Best?
Polycarbonate with a textured finish resists scratches the best, helping your luggage look newer for longer. Aluminum is an option if you prioritize toughness, but it dents more easily and shows marks.
